About the author: quoting from the book's back cover: "A minister for nearly 50 years, Frank Schulman is emeritus chaplain, dean and fellow in theology at Harris Manchester College at Oxford University. He is the author of several books. . ." When he reviewed this book, Charles Howe wrote, "Schulman is to be commended for striking a rarely achieved balance between both Unitarian and Universalist and American and European history." This work contains a glossary, a list of resources and, even show more a page explaining how to use the book. It is well-indexed. show less
